| dc.description | In this report, we simulate practical feature of Yuen-Kim protocol for quantum key distribution with unconditional secure. In order to demonstrate them experimentally by intensity modulation/direct detection(IMDD) optical fiber communication system, we use simplified encoding scheme to guarantee security for key information(1 or 0). That is, pairwise M-ary intensity modulation scheme is employed. Furthermore, we give an experimental implementation of YK protocol based on IMDD. | |
